Nissan and Infiniti Recall <br />More Than 1.2 Million Vehicles.<br />The issue with the affected <br />vehicles has to do with the <br />backup cameras installed <br />in various new models.<br />Such cameras are now <br />required in all new cars <br />by Federal Motor Vehicle <br />Safety Standards.<br />The issue with the cameras <br />has to do with the rear-view <br />image display when the <br />cars are in reverse.<br />Based on a setting applied by the driver, <br />it's possible that the image could be removed.<br />All affected vehicles <br />are 2018-2019 models.<br />They include the Nissan Altima, Sentra, <br />Titan, Versa Note, Versa Sedan, Frontier, <br />GT-R, Rogue, Rogue Sport, Kicks, Leaf, <br />Maxima, Murano, NV, NV200 and Pathfinder.<br />Infiniti models include <br />the Q50, Q60, QX30, QX50, <br />QX60, Q70, Q70L and QX80.<br />Owners of affected vehicles need to <br />simply visit a dealer to have the issue fixed
